*** CHEMICAL IDENTIFICATION ***
RTECS NUMBER : TI1400000
CHEMICAL NAME : Phthalic acid, di(methoxyethyl) ester
CAS REGISTRY NUMBER : 117-82-8
BEILSTEIN REFERENCE NO. : 2056929
REFERENCE : 4-09-00-03241 (Beilstein Handbook Reference)
LAST UPDATED : 199710
DATA ITEMS CITED : 29
MOLECULAR FORMULA : C14-H18-O6
MOLECULAR WEIGHT : 282.32
WISWESSER LINE NOTATION : 1O2OVR BVO2O1
COMPOUND DESCRIPTOR : Mutagen
Reproductive Effector
Primary Irritant
SYNONYMS/TRADE NAMES :
* 1,2-Benzenedicarboxylic acid, bis(2-methoxyethyl) ester
* Bis(methoxyethyl) phthalate
* Bis(2-methoxyethyl) phthalate
* Di-(2-methoxyethyl)ester kyseliny ftalove
* Dimethoxy ethyl phthalate
* Di(2-methoxyethyl)phthalate
* DMEP
* Kesscoflex MCP
* 2-Methoxyethyl phthalate
* Phthalic acid, bis(2-methoxyethyl) ester
*** HEALTH HAZARD DATA ***
** SKIN/EYE IRRITATION DATA **
TYPE OF TEST : Standard Draize test
ROUTE OF EXPOSURE : Administration into the eye
SPECIES OBSERVED : Rodent - rabbit
DOSE/DURATION : 100 mg
REACTION SEVERITY : Mild
REFERENCE :
KODAK* Kodak Company Reports. (343 State St., Rochester, NY 14650)
Volume(issue)/page/year: #902511
TYPE OF TEST : Standard Draize test
ROUTE OF EXPOSURE : Administration onto the skin
SPECIES OBSERVED : Rodent - guinea pig
DOSE/DURATION : 500 mg
REACTION SEVERITY : Mild
REFERENCE :
KODAK* Kodak Company Reports. (343 State St., Rochester, NY 14650)
Volume(issue)/page/year: #902511
** ACUTE TOXICITY DATA **
TYPE OF TEST : LDLo - Lowest published lethal dose
ROUTE OF EXPOSURE : Oral
SPECIES OBSERVED : Rodent - rat
DOSE/DURATION : 2750 mg/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
REFERENCE :
29ZWAE "Practical Toxicology of Plastics," Lefaux, R., Cleveland, OH,
Chemical Rubber Co., 1968 Volume(issue)/page/year: -,356,1968
TYPE OF TEST : LCLo - Lowest published lethal concentration
ROUTE OF EXPOSURE : Inhalation
SPECIES OBSERVED : Rodent - rat
DOSE/DURATION : 1595 ppm/6H
TOXIC EFFECTS :
Sense Organs and Special Senses (Olfaction) - effect, not otherwise
specified
REFERENCE :
14CYAT "Industrial Hygiene and Toxicology," 2nd ed., Patty, F.A., ed., New
York, John Wiley & Sons, Inc., 1958-63 Volume(issue)/page/year: 2,1905,1963
TYPE OF TEST : L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E : Intraperitoneal
SPECIES OBSERVED : Rodent - rat
DOSE/DURATION : 3736 uL/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
REFERENCE :
JPMSAE Journal of Pharmaceutical Sciences. (American Pharmaceutical Assoc.,
2215 Constitution Ave., NW, Washington, DC 20037) V.50- 1961-
Volume(issue)/page/year: 61,51,1972
TYPE OF TEST : L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E : Oral
SPECIES OBSERVED : Rodent - mouse
DOSE/DURATION : 3200 mg/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
REFERENCE :
14CYAT "Industrial Hygiene and Toxicology," 2nd ed., Patty, F.A., ed., New
York, John Wiley & Sons, Inc., 1958-63 Volume(issue)/page/year: 2,1904,1963
TYPE OF TEST : L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E : Intraperitoneal
SPECIES OBSERVED : Rodent - mouse
DOSE/DURATION : 2510 mg/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
REFERENCE :
34ZIAG "Toxicology of Drugs and Chemicals," Deichmann, W.B., New York,
Academic Press, Inc., 1969 Volume(issue)/page/year: -,691,1969
TYPE OF TEST : L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E : Administration onto the skin
SPECIES OBSERVED : Rodent - guinea pig
DOSE/DURATION : >20 gm/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
REFERENCE :
EPASR* United States Environmental Protection Agency, Office of Pesticides
and Toxic Substances. (U.S. Environmental Protection Agency, 401 M St., SW,
Washington, DC 20460) History unknown. Volume(issue)/page/year:
8EHQ-0391-1170
** OTHER MULTIPLE DOSE TOXICITY DATA **
TYPE OF TEST : TDLo - Lowest published toxic dose
ROUTE OF EXPOSURE : Intraperitoneal
SPECIES OBSERVED : Rodent - mouse
DOSE/DURATION : 10500 mg/kg/6W-I
TOXIC EFFECTS :
Related to Chronic Data - changes in testicular weight
REFERENCE :
JPMSAE Journal of Pharmaceutical Sciences. (American Pharmaceutical Assoc.,
2215 Constitution Ave., NW, Washington, DC 20037) V.50- 1961-
Volume(issue)/page/year: 55,158,1966
** REPRODUCTIVE DATA **
TYPE OF TEST : TDLo - Lowest published toxic dose
ROUTE OF EXPOSURE : Oral
SPECIES OBSERVED : Rodent - rat
DOSE : 1500 mg/kg
SEX/DURATION : male 1 day(s) pre-mating
TOXIC EFFECTS :
Reproductive - Paternal Effects - spermatogenesis (incl. genetic material,
sperm morphology, motility, and count)
Reproductive - Paternal Effects - testes, epididymis, sperm duct
REFERENCE :
TJADAB Teratology, The International Journal of Abnormal Development. (Alan
R. Liss, Inc., 41 E. 11th St., New York, NY 10003) V.1- 1968-
Volume(issue)/page/year: 26(3),14A,1982
TYPE OF TEST : TDLo - Lowest published toxic dose
ROUTE OF EXPOSURE : Oral
SPECIES OBSERVED : Rodent - rat
DOSE : 593 mg/kg
SEX/DURATION : female 10 day(s) after conception
TOXIC EFFECTS :
Reproductive - Specific Developmental Abnormalities - Central Nervous System
Reproductive - Specific Developmental Abnormalities - eye/ear
Reproductive - Specific Developmental Abnormalities - cardiovascular
(circulatory) system
REFERENCE :
TJADAB Teratology, The International Journal of Abnormal Development. (Alan
R. Liss, Inc., 41 E. 11th St., New York, NY 10003) V.1- 1968-
Volume(issue)/page/year: 33,93C,1986
TYPE OF TEST : TDLo - Lowest published toxic dose
ROUTE OF EXPOSURE : Oral
SPECIES OBSERVED : Rodent - rat
DOSE : 593 mg/kg
SEX/DURATION : female 13 day(s) after conception
TOXIC EFFECTS :
Reproductive - Specific Developmental Abnormalities - musculoskeletal system
Reproductive - Specific Developmental Abnormalities - urogenital system
REFERENCE :
TJADAB Teratology, The International Journal of Abnormal Development. (Alan
R. Liss, Inc., 41 E. 11th St., New York, NY 10003) V.1- 1968-
Volume(issue)/page/year: 33,93C,1986
TYPE OF TEST : TDLo - Lowest published toxic dose
ROUTE OF EXPOSURE : Intraperitoneal
SPECIES OBSERVED : Rodent - rat
DOSE : 500 mg/kg
SEX/DURATION : female 12 day(s) after conception
TOXIC EFFECTS :
Reproductive - Specific Developmental Abnormalities - musculoskeletal system
Reproductive - Specific Developmental Abnormalities - cardiovascular
(circulatory) system
REFERENCE :
TJADAB Teratology, The International Journal of Abnormal Development. (Alan
R. Liss, Inc., 41 E. 11th St., New York, NY 10003) V.1- 1968-
Volume(issue)/page/year: 29(2),54A,1984
TYPE OF TEST : TDLo - Lowest published toxic dose
ROUTE OF EXPOSURE : Intraperitoneal
SPECIES OBSERVED : Rodent - rat
DOSE : 374 mg/kg
SEX/DURATION : female 5-15 day(s) after conception
TOXIC EFFECTS :
Reproductive - Fertility - post-implantation mortality (e.g. dead and/or
resorbed implants per total number of implants)
Reproductive - Effects on Embryo or Fetus - fetotoxicity (except death,
e.g., stunted fetus)
Reproductive - Effects on Embryo or Fetus - fetal death
REFERENCE :
JPMSAE Journal of Pharmaceutical Sciences. (American Pharmaceutical Assoc.,
2215 Constitution Ave., NW, Washington, DC 20037) V.50- 1961-
Volume(issue)/page/year: 61,51,1972
TYPE OF TEST : TDLo - Lowest published toxic dose
ROUTE OF EXPOSURE : Intraperitoneal
SPECIES OBSERVED : Rodent - rat
DOSE : 374 mg/kg
SEX/DURATION : female 5-15 day(s) after conception
TOXIC EFFECTS :
Reproductive - Specific Developmental Abnormalities - musculoskeletal system
REFERENCE :
JPMSAE Journal of Pharmaceutical Sciences. (American Pharmaceutical Assoc.,
2215 Constitution Ave., NW, Washington, DC 20037) V.50- 1961-
Volume(issue)/page/year: 61,51,1972
TYPE OF TEST : TDLo - Lowest published toxic dose
ROUTE OF EXPOSURE : Intraperitoneal
SPECIES OBSERVED : Rodent - rat
DOSE : 747 mg/kg
SEX/DURATION : female 5-15 day(s) after conception
TOXIC EFFECTS :
Reproductive - Specific Developmental Abnormalities - eye/ear
Reproductive - Specific Developmental Abnormalities - other developmental
abnormalities
REFERENCE :
JPMSAE Journal of Pharmaceutical Sciences. (American Pharmaceutical Assoc.,
2215 Constitution Ave., NW, Washington, DC 20037) V.50- 1961-
Volume(issue)/page/year: 61,51,1972
TYPE OF TEST : TDLo - Lowest published toxic dose
ROUTE OF EXPOSURE : Intraperitoneal
SPECIES OBSERVED : Rodent - rat
DOSE : 600 mg/kg
SEX/DURATION : female 12 day(s) after conception
TOXIC EFFECTS :
Reproductive - Specific Developmental Abnormalities - Central Nervous System
Reproductive - Specific Developmental Abnormalities - musculoskeletal system
REFERENCE :
EVHPAZ EHP, Environmental Health Perspectives. (U.S. Government Printing
Office, Supt of Documents, Washington, DC 20402) No.1- 1972-
Volume(issue)/page/year: 45,89,1982
TYPE OF TEST : TDLo - Lowest published toxic dose
ROUTE OF EXPOSURE : Intraperitoneal
SPECIES OBSERVED : Rodent - mouse
DOSE : 2380 mg/kg
SEX/DURATION : male 1 day(s) pre-mating
TOXIC EFFECTS :
Reproductive - Fertility - pre-implantation mortality (e.g. reduction in
number of implants per female; total number of implants per corpora lutea)
Reproductive - Fertility - litter size (e.g. # fetuses per litter; measured
before birth)
Reproductive - Effects on Embryo or Fetus - fetal death
REFERENCE :
EVHPAZ EHP, Environmental Health Perspectives. (U.S. Government Printing
Office, Supt of Documents, Washington, DC 20402) No.1- 1972-
Volume(issue)/page/year: 3,81,1973
TYPE OF TEST : TDLo - Lowest published toxic dose
ROUTE OF EXPOSURE : Intraperitoneal
SPECIES OBSERVED : Rodent - mouse
DOSE : 2380 ug/kg
SEX/DURATION : male 1 day(s) pre-mating
TOXIC EFFECTS :
Reproductive - Fertility - male fertility index (e.g. # males impregnating
females per # males exposed to fertile nonpregnant females)
REFERENCE :
TXAPA9 Toxicology and Applied Pharmacology. (Academic Press, Inc., 1 E.
First St., Duluth, MN 55802) V.1- 1959- Volume(issue)/page/year:
29,35,1974
